Evaluating Dog Breeders

by E-NewsCast Team
August 31st, 2009

Before you can determine whether or not a particular dog will be of value to you there are two basic items that must be addressed. One, you must know the breed of dog you want. Are you after a German Shepherd, Bernese Mountain dog, Newfoundland, Yorkshire Terrier or other type? If it’s a German Shepherd that you want you should be looking for german shepherd dog breeders. And two, you must be aware of some specific information about that breed. The information you need to be versed on includes the correct size for your dog breed, how often it needs to be brushed, how much activity or exercise it needs daily, if there are genetic diseases that are common with this type, have there been tests performed that have ruled these diseases out in this pup, and what else is required in maintaining it’s health such as clipping its nails….

Why Is Black Elderberry Such A Powerful Flu Fighter?

by E-NewsCast Team
August 31st, 2009

According to the “Handbook of Medicinal Herbs,” black elderberryleaves were touted by European herbalists to be pain relievingand to promote healing of injuries when applied as a poultice.Native American herbalists used the plant for infections,coughs, and skin conditions.Black elderberry is a plant that grows primarily in Europe andNorth America. It’s a natural remedy with three flavonoids thathave antiviral properties. Flavonoids are very effective againstdifferent strains of influenza virus. Black elderberry also hasother compounds, called anthocyanins, which have ananti-inflammatory effect, thus reducing aches and pains.A popular brand is Sambucol.
